Type
Offshore patrol vessel Displacement
- Batch 1: 1,700 t (1,700 long tons)[2][1]
- Batch 2: 2,000 t (2,000 long tons)[5][4]
Length
- Batch 1: 79.5 m (260 ft 10 in)[1][3]
- Batch 2: 90.5 m (296 ft 11 in)[2][5][4]
Beam
- Batch 1: 13.5 m (44 ft 3 in)[2][1]
- Batch 2: 13.5 m (44 ft 3 in)[2][5]
Draught Batch 1: 3.8 m (12 ft 6 in)
